*Flashback*

Star's P.O.V.~

I got off the plane to LA and instantly searched for my suitcases. "Welcome home my little Starburst." My dad exclaimed, smiling at me. I gave him a weak smile and continued to search for my bags. "Star Benson?" I turned to the voice who said my name. I found a boy around my age with black hair, holding my bags. "That's me! Thank you so much." I took the black duffel bags from his pale hands. "Xander, Xander Mills. And you're Star." He smiled gently at me, showing off his white teeth. "Wanna give me your number? I mean I've been sound here for about two years. I could show you around, make a new friend?" I nodded softly and plugged my number into his cellphone. "I'll see you around."

I let out a small smile and walked to the cab my dad was waiting in. I took a look at my surroundings, slightly admiring the view of the sunset shining over the skyscrapers. I didn't feel it until I was staring out the window. The feeling of emptiness. Alone. Betrayal. A single tear slid down my cheeks as I thought of how quickly he was to turn his back and not bother to listen. But why should he? I hurt him. After promising I wouldn't.

I stepped out of the car, staring wide eyed at the tall brick house in front of me. I estimated it being at least three stories high. I slowly dragged my suitcases up the pathway surrounded by beautiful rose bushes. "Well, here it is. How do you like it?" I shrugged and walked inside. The first room I walked into was the living room. A girl clearly younger than me was curled up on the couch listening to music wrapped under a cheetah blanket. "Kate, this is my daughter Star. Star, this is Marybeth's daughter, your step sister." She nodded shyly and said hello.

I walked into a spare bedroom with light blue walls and a queen sized bed. I stared in awe at the lavender comforters and pitch black vanity against the wall. I set down the suitcases on the bed and began to unpack.

.........

I pulled up my sweat pants to my knees and set up my laptop. I heard my phone go off, seeing a text from an unknown number.

-Hey, it's Xander from the airport- I lazily saved his number to my contacts before messaging him back.

-Hey Xander from the airport, what're you doing?-
-skateboard, you?-
-laying down. Where do you live anyway?-
-small apartment around Grand Ave. How about you newbie?-
-1507 S Mansfield Ave.-

I looked through Facebook and saw Violet posted something to my timeline. A picture of Sunni, Violet, and I when we just started tenth grade in front of our old tree. I sucked in a deep breath and closed my laptop.

-Xander, do you wanna hang out tonight? I could use a tour guide?-

I refuse to sit in my room and mope. I pull over my tank top and put on a grey tshirt with Jack Skellington on it and some jean shorts and walk downstairs. "I'm going out to explore, I'll be back later."

-Sure, I'll pick you up in five-

I paced their- my front yard until I saw a black Honda Civic SI pull into my driveway. My jaw drops as he climbs out of the car, gesturing me to go to the passenger side. He opens the door for me before jogging over to the other side. "Where to?" He asks, pressing the button to start the car. "Anywhere."

He took me to the park, a beautiful one in fact. Fountains and beautiful trees. We sat in the shadows of a willow tree and learned more about each other. He's 17 years old, dropped out of school at age 16, moved here away from his parents when he was 15 and wants to work for some sort of company someday. "Thank you..." I mumble, picking at the bright green of the grass. "For?" His soft voice asks. "I'm just a stranger, and you've been so welcoming." He smiled at me before dazing off with his smoky grey eyes.

I went back home that night, knowing that even if I had to lose some people to become happy, I'd always have someone. But I couldn't help thinking back to Andrew. No matter what I did, I was determined I'd never fully be over him.

We were suppose to be forever. And that's when I realized, even the stars can't shine without darkness.
